Ottoman dynasty - Wikipedia … WebGrammar - The Ottomans were not happy with only borrowing words. They borrowed whole grammatical structures from Arabic and Persian. Take for example a look at the name of the language itself. In Ottoman Turkish, the Ottoman language is called Lisân-ı Osmânî. Lisân the Arabic word for language, and -ı/î the particle that marks possession.

The rise of nationalism in the Ottoman Empire dates from at least 1821. Arab nationalism has its roots in the Mashriq (the Arab lands east of Egypt), particularly in countries of the Levant. The political orientation of Arab nationalists before World War I was generally moderate. The Ottoman Empire ruled the Arab World for many centuries. They conquered the areas of Syria, the Hejaz, Iraq, and Egypt from the Mamluk Sultanate in the 16th century, Mesopotamia from the Safavids also in the 16th century, and North Africa by the end of the 16th century. boot stick für windows 10 erstellenWebMar 25, 2024 · The final way to easily tell Persian from Arabic and Kurdish is through numbers.
